The following information can help you estimate the standard expenses of being a Meadville Lombard student in the Master of Divinity (MDiv) program. Cost of Attendance is used in calculating financial aid, including grants and loans.
The charts below use the 2025/2026 tuition and fees in the calculations.
The Master of Divinity program is a 3-year, 90-credit degree program. Of those 90 credits, 6 are non-tuition-based credits usually taken in the first year. The chart below estimates the cost of attendance for the first year, and the second/third years of the MDiv program.

The following information can help you estimate the standard expenses of being a Meadville Lombard student in the Master of Arts (Religion) (MAR) program. Cost of Attendance is used in calculating financial aid, including grants and loans.
The charts below use the 2025/2026 Tuition and fees in the calculations.
The Master of Arts (Religion) program is a 2-year, 36-credit degree program. The chart below estimates the yearly cost of attendance for the MAR program.

The following information can help you estimate the standard expenses of being a Meadville Lombard student in the Doctor of Ministry (DMin) program. Cost of Attendance is used in calculating financial aid, including grants and loans.
The charts below use the 2025/2026 Tuition and Fees in the calculations.
The Doctor of Ministry program is a 3-year, 30-credit degree program. The chart below estimates the cost of attendance for the first and second years, and the final year of the DMin program.

Students taking courses who have not matriculated into a Meadville Lombard degree program are considered “students at large.” These students still need to register. If you are a student at large, the tuition you pay will depend on whether you are auditing a course or taking it for credit. Students at large can expect the following tuition and fees:
